description = [[
|
|
Performs brute force password auditing against the pcAnywhere remote access protocol.
|
|
|
|
Due to certain limitations of the protocol, bruteforcing
|
|
is limited to single thread at a time.
|
|
After a valid login pair is guessed the script waits
|
|
some time until server becomes available again.
|
|
|
|
]]
|
|
|
|
---
|
|
-- @usage
|
|
-- nmap --script=pcanywhere-brute <target>
|
|
--
|
|
-- @output
|
|
-- 5631/tcp open pcanywheredata syn-ack
|
|
-- | pcanywhere-brute:
|
|
-- | Accounts
|
|
-- | administrator:administrator - Valid credentials
|
|
-- | Statistics
|
|
-- |_ Performed 2 guesses in 55 seconds, average tps: 0
|
|
|
|
|
|
author = "Aleksandar Nikolic"
|
|
license = "Same as Nmap--See http://nmap.org/book/man-legal.html"
|
|
categories = {"intrusive", "brute"}

-- implements simple xor based encryption which the server expects
|
|
local function encrypt(data)
|
|
local result = {}
|
|
local xor_key = 0xab
|
|
local k = 0
|
|
if data then
|
|
result[1] = bit.bxor(string.byte(data),xor_key)
|
|
for i = 2,string.len(data) do
|
|
result[i] = bit.bxor(result[i-1],string.byte(data,i),i-2)
|
|
end
|
|
end
|
|
return string.char(table.unpack(result))
|
|
end
